#496410 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#496410 is composed of 28.6% red, 39.2% green and 6.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 27% cyan, 0% magenta, 84% yellow and 60.8% black. It has a hue angle of 79.3 degrees, a saturation of 72.4% and a lightness of 22.7%. #496410 color hex could be obtained by blending #92c820 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336600.

Shades and Tints of #496410
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0f02 is the darkest color, while #fefffe is the lightest one.

Tones of #496410
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3b3c38 is the less saturated color, while #4e7103 is the most saturated one.
